The crash happens currently when there are more than one loading session history entries at the same time and when
the latter load then accesses current active entry, it has already the bfcached frameloader.
I have tried and failed to write a testcase for this. The Pernosco record is from running
https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/source/devtools/client/webconsole/test/browser/browser_webconsole_message_categories.js
and the crash has happened when there is a race condition between a load initiated in the parent process and another load initiated in a child
process.
The patch tries to make the setup rather safe. If active entry has changed or it has gotten frameloader, don't try to bfcache.

This allows loads to be tracked as they are ongoing on a per-context basis in
the parent process, and for events to be generated for each subframe as it is
destroyed.
This patch also stops sending the `IsLoadingDocument` flag on the request to
the main process and removes RemoteWebProgress, as they are no longer necessary
due to being tracked directly.
Finally this patch also adds some logging to BrowsingContextWebProgress
to make it easier to diagnose this type of issue in the future.

With Fission, there can be multiple BrowserParents in a single tab, so
this patch moves the tracking of active tabs onto the top BrowsingContext
in a tab. If the priority of a top BC is changed, then the activity
of all of the BPs of the BCs in the tree are all adjusted. The flag
that tracks this state gets carried forward to the new BC in the case
of a cross-group navigation by the changes in ReplacedBy().
The other change here covers the case where we do a process-switching
navigation on an iframe. If we create a new BrowserParent with an active
top BC, then the BP gets marked as active in the priority manager. Doing
this tracking on the BP instead of the BC (both here in and in the part
that landed previously in BrowserParent::Deactivated()) means that we
don't need to track down every place that a BC switches processes.
I left the tracking of activity in ParticularProcessPriorityManager
centered around BrowserParents, instead of changing it to BCs, to
minimize the changes required. There are some tricky interactions there
with wakelocks that I didn't want to have to figure out.
browser_ProcessPriorityManager.js was set up to track a mapping of
browsers to priorities, but for the purposes of testing Fission support
I changed it to track a mapping of child IDs to priorities.
In the test, I also removed an assignment (this.window = null) that
didn't seem to be doing anything.

This patch contains a large number of changes around the process switching
mechanism in order to avoid issues which are caused by a mismatched
understanding of the state of the process switch between processes in the
presence of nested event loops.
This includes:
1. The "InFlightProcessId" value is no longer recorded. All remaining uses
were removed in part 1, and the new mechanism tracks this information in
a better way.
2. The current BrowserParent instance is now tracked on
CanonicalBrowsingContext, meaning that logic which needs to work with this
information can now access it without depending on the current
WindowGlobalParent instance.
3. When doing a process switch, the previous host process for the
BrowsingContext is tracked until the process switch is completed, allowing
for future attempts to switch into that process to be delayed until the
previous unload event has finished running.
4. The process switch logic was refactored to simplify some of the
error-handling logic, and share more code between different cases.

This URI is intended to reflect the currentURI field on the content nsIDocShell,
and is the value used for getters like `window.location.href`. For most
documents, this generally matches the Document URI on WindowGlobalParent, it
does not match in specific cases such as error pages or when performing a
session restore.
The field is kept up-to-date by listening to `OnLocationChange` notifications
from the content process, and is ignored when the BrowsingContext is loaded in
the parent process.
